Understanding the Importance of Women’s Hiking Socks

When it comes to hiking, your feet are your most valuable asset. They endure the strain of each step, absorb shock, and support your body throughout your journey. Women’s hiking socks play a crucial role in ensuring the comfort, protection, and overall well-being of your feet. They act as a barrier between your skin and the hiking boots, reducing friction and preventing blisters. Additionally, hiking socks are designed to provide cushioning, support, moisture-wicking properties, and durability, making them an essential part of your hiking gear.

What Sets Women’s Hiking Socks Apart?

Women’s hiking socks are specifically designed to cater to the unique needs of female hikers. They are engineered to provide optimal fit, comfort, and support for women’s feet. These socks take into consideration factors such as arch shape, calf size, and foot volume, ensuring a snug fit and reducing the risk of discomfort or chafing during your hikes. With a wide range of styles, materials, and features available, women’s hiking socks offer a personalized and tailored experience for female adventurers.

Factors to Consider When Choosing Women’s Hiking Socks

Selecting the right pair of women’s hiking socks requires careful consideration of various factors. Keep the following points in mind when making your choice:

1. Materials: Finding the Perfect Blend of Comfort and Durability The material of your hiking socks plays a significant role in determining their comfort and durability. Look for socks made from high-quality, moisture-wicking materials such as merino wool, synthetic blends, or a combination of both. Merino wool is an excellent choice as it offers temperature regulation, odor control, and natural moisture-wicking properties. Synthetic blends, on the other hand, provide durability, quick-drying capabilities, and breathability. Consider your personal preferences, the climate you’ll be hiking in, and the specific features offered by different materials.

2. Cushioning: Striking the Right Balance Cushioning is essential for absorbing shock and providing comfort during long hikes. Look for socks with adequate cushioning in the heel, toe, and ball of the foot areas. However, it’s crucial to strike the right balance as excessive cushioning can lead to a tight fit and reduced breathability. Opt for socks with moderate cushioning that offer a comfortable feel without compromising on performance.

3. Moisture-Wicking and Breathability: Keeping Feet Fresh and Dry One of the key features to consider in women’s hiking socks is their moisture-wicking and breathability properties. Hiking can make your feet sweat, and dampness can lead to discomfort and blisters. Choose socks that efficiently wick moisture away from the skin, keeping your feet dry and comfortable. Look for designs with mesh panels or ventilation channels for enhanced breathability.

4. Arch Support and Compression: Extra Comfort for Long Hikes Supportive socks with arch compression can help alleviate foot fatigue and provide additional stability during long hikes. Look for socks that offer targeted arch support and compression to prevent discomfort and promote proper foot alignment. This feature is particularly beneficial for those with high arches or those prone to foot pain.

5. Length: Finding the Ideal Height for Your Needs Hiking socks come in various lengths, including ankle, crew, and knee-high options. The choice of length depends on personal preference, hiking conditions, and the type of footwear you’ll be wearing. Crew-length socks are a popular choice as they provide ample coverage and protection without being too bulky. Consider the terrain, weather, and your comfort level when selecting the appropriate sock height.

6. Seamless Design: Minimizing Friction and Blisters Blisters can quickly ruin a hiking experience, so choosing socks with a seamless design is crucial. Seamless socks minimize friction and reduce the risk of blisters and hot spots. Look for flat toe seams or seamless constructions that ensure a smooth and irritation-free fit.

7. Fit and Sizing: Ensuring the Perfect Match Proper fit and sizing are paramount for women’s hiking socks. Ill-fitting socks can bunch up, cause discomfort, and lead to blisters. Refer to the manufacturer’s sizing chart and measure your feet to find the right size. Additionally, pay attention to features like stretchability and elasticized cuffs, which contribute to a secure and comfortable fit.

8. Durability: Socks That Can Keep Up With Your Adventures Hiking socks should be built to withstand the rigors of the trails. Look for socks with reinforced heels, toes, and soles for enhanced durability. High-quality stitching and construction contribute to longevity, ensuring that your socks can handle multiple hikes without wearing out quickly.

How to Care for Your Women’s Hiking Socks

To ensure the longevity and performance of your women’s hiking socks, follow these care tips:

  1.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for washing and drying your socks. Some socks may require delicate machine wash or hand wash.
  2. Use a mild detergent that is suitable for wool or synthetic fabrics. Avoid using bleach or fabric softeners, as they can degrade the sock’s materials.
  3. Turn your socks inside out before washing to protect the outer surface and maintain their appearance.
  4. Wash your socks in cold or lukewarm water to prevent shrinkage or damage to the fibers.
  5. Air-dry your socks whenever possible. If using a dryer, use a low heat setting to prevent excessive shrinking or deformation.
  6. Avoid ironing your hiking socks, as high heat can damage the materials.

By following these care instructions, you can keep your women’s hiking socks in excellent condition, ensuring their performance and longevity on the trails.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

  1. What are the benefits of wearing women’s hiking socks? Women’s hiking socks provide comfort, support, moisture-wicking properties, and durability. They protect against friction and blisters, regulate temperature, and keep feet dry and comfortable during hikes.
  2. How often should I replace my hiking socks? It is recommended to replace your hiking socks every 6 to 12 months or when you notice significant wear, thinning, or loss of cushioning. Regularly inspect your socks for signs of damage and replace them as needed.
  3. Can I wear regular socks for hiking? Regular socks may not offer the same level of support, cushioning, and moisture-wicking capabilities as hiking socks. It is advisable to invest in specialized hiking socks for optimal comfort and protection during hikes.
  4. Are wool socks suitable for hiking in warm climates? Wool socks can be suitable for hiking in warm climates, depending on the specific blend and thickness of the wool. Merino wool, in particular, is known for its temperature-regulating properties. It can wick away moisture from the skin, keeping your feet dry and comfortable even in warm conditions. Look for lightweight and breathable wool socks specifically designed for warm-weather hiking to ensure optimal comfort.
  1. Can women’s hiking socks help prevent blisters? Yes, women’s hiking socks are designed to minimize friction and reduce the risk of blisters. The cushioning, seamless construction, and moisture-wicking properties of hiking socks help prevent rubbing and irritation, keeping your feet blister-free during long hikes.

  2. What are the best socks for long-distance hiking? The best socks for long-distance hiking are those that offer a combination of cushioning, moisture-wicking properties, durability, and a comfortable fit. Look for socks with targeted arch support, seamless construction, and a blend of materials like merino wool and synthetic fibers to ensure optimum performance and comfort during extended hikes.
